The bachelor's program at William Paterson University was ranked #312 on College Factual's Best Schools for cis list. It is also ranked #13 in New Jersey.
During the 2020-2021 academic year, William Paterson University of New Jersey handed out 87 bachelor's degrees in computer information systems. This is an increase of 7% over the previous year when 81 degrees were handed out.
The median salary of cis students who receive their bachelor's degree at William Paterson University is $48,054. Unfortunately, this is lower than the national average of $53,242 for all cis students.
While getting their bachelor's degree at William Paterson University, cis students borrow a median amount of $26,750 in student loans. This is higher than the the typical median of $26,063 for all cis majors across the country.

In the 2020-2021 academic year, 87 students earned a bachelor's degree in cis from William Paterson University. About 10% of these graduates were women and the other 90% were men.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from William Paterson University of New Jersey with a bachelor's in cis.
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
---|---|
Asian | 15 |
Black or African American | 11 |
Hispanic or Latino | 22 |
White | 35 |
Non-Resident Aliens | 2 |
Other Races | 2 |
